Middle Eastern actress Yara Shahidi is the new face of Jean Paul Gaultier’s “Divine” campaign, promoting the luxury brand’s latest elixir fragrance. The French brand has just launched the Divine perfume as a concentrated elixir, featuring Shahidi and model Raphael Diogo in the campaign photos.
Perfumed by Quentin Bisch, the combination of flowery and marine impressions, and the fragrance was launched in 2023. Its elixir version is cruelty-free, vegan, and comprises 90 percent of responsibly sourced natural ingredients, which further demonstrates the brand’s commitment to sustainability.
In the campaign, Shahidi can be seen in a gold sequined gown holding the fragrance, and in another look, she wears a black velvet top decorated with gold details, demonstrating her style and charm.
Shahidi previously worked with Jean Paul Gaultier in the 2023 campaign, alongside Spanish actress Lola Rodriquez, South African model Thando Hopa, US actress Tess McMillan, Lagos-born model Janet Jumbo, and Brazilian model Ana Elisa de Brito. She also had a hand in casting and creative decision-making, and this aspect was inherent to the message of the campaign celebrating women.
Outside of fashion, Shahidi is an accomplished actress, activist, and social advocate. She graduated from Harvard and started the platform Eighteen x 18 to motivate young people in the US to vote. She was named one of Time Magazine’s Most Influential Teens in 2016 and was recently listed by National Geographic among 33 “visionaries, creators, icons, and adventurers.”
The star also hosts The Optimist Project podcast, exploring ways to live a more meaningful life through conversations with various guests.
